Can Bge Cut You Off In The Winter? Winter Restrictions
From November 1 through March 31, BGE will not terminate residential utility service for nonpayment unless it is first certified to the Maryland Public Service Commission that the customer has been notified of the pending termination.

Can your electric be shut off in the winter in Maryland? There is no such thing as a winter moratorium on service terminations in Maryland.

There are limits on winter shut-offs, in addition to the extreme weather limitation.
The utility cannot terminate service for a bill of gas or electric bill of $200 or less, or $300 or less for a combined gas and electric company.

How much do utilities cost in Maryland?

According to 2017 data from the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A), the average monthly utility bill in Maryland is $131.16. That’s just about $20 above the national average of $111.67, which is good for the fifth highest monthly rate in the U.S.
